About

Topaz Farm is a 130-acre family farm on Sauvie Island known for u-pick produce, farm-to-plate dinners under a 500-year-old oak tree, and seasonal outdoor concerts. Its Harvest Fest and summer shows have featured artists like Colin Meloy, Blind Pilot, and The Helio Sequence, with some concerts drawing around 1,600 attendees for relaxed lawn-style viewing amid fields and wildflowers. It’s a standalone destination just across the St. Johns Bridge from North Portland.

Getting there

Parking

Free on-site grass parking; single entrance/exit so carpooling is encouraged. No RVs, buses or oversized vehicles on-site; free oversized/overnight parking is available at the Sauvie Island bridge lot about one mile away. Bike parking is near the farm market; rideshare can be unreliable departing, so Uber Reserve or Radio Cab pickup at the entrance is recommended.

Public transit

TriMet Line 16 (Front Ave/St Helens Rd) serves Sauvie Island with a stop near the bridge at NW Gillihan Rd & Sauvie Island; from there it’s approximately 1.6 miles along NW Sauvie Island Rd to the farm, so plan to walk/bike or arrange rideshare.
